Responsibilities

  • Performs ongoing, systematic collection and analysis of patient data pre - during - post hemodialysis treatment for assigned patients and documents in the patient medical record.
  • Adjusts or modifies the treatment plan as indicated and notifies Team Leader, Charge Nurse, Clinical Manager or Physician as needed.
  • Recognizes aspects and implications of patient status that vary from normal and reports to or collaborates with appropriate health team members for input.
  • Assesses daily assigned patient care needs and collaborates with direct and ancillary patient care staff as needed.
  • Directs and provides, in collaboration with direct and ancillary patient care staff, all aspects of the daily provision of safe and effective delivery of chronic hemodialysis therapy to assigned patients.
  • Administers medications as prescribed or in accordance with approved algorithm(s), and documents appropriate medical justification and effectiveness.
  • Ensures correct laboratory collection, processing and shipping procedures are performed and reschedules missed or insufficient laboratory collections.
  • Ensures physician orders for assigned patients are entered and acknowledged in the Medical Record.
  • Initiates or assists with emergency response measures.
  • Delegates appropriate tasks to direct patient care staff including but not limited to LVN/LPNs and Patient Care Technicians.
  • Monitors patient care staff for appropriate techniques and adherence to FKC policy and procedures.
  • Promotes infection control, equipment and environmental safety.
  • Assesses, collaborates and documents patient/family's basic learning needs to provide initial and ongoing education to patients and family.
  • Identifies expected outcomes, documents and updates the nursing assessment and plan of care for assigned patients through collaboration with the Interdisciplinary Team.
  • Ensures patient awareness related to transplant and treatment modality options.
  • Makes referrals to Social Worker and Registered Dietitian as appropriate for individual patient education and counseling.
